Genre: Young Adult Romance
Publishing date: August 6th, 2024
Synopsis:
Keep your friends close. Keep your nemesis closer.
After nearly five years of avoiding him, Briggs Goswick may have appeared at my feet on horseback like a handsome white knight but, in fact, he is a certified man-child.
Briggs may be many thingsโa society darling (annoying), attractive (so unfair), and heir to an elite family (helpful)โbut after humiliating me at a ball several years ago, he is primarily my archnemesis.
His presence has made this summer go from bad toโฆcomplicated. I have the weight of saving my familyโs name and finances solely on my shoulders, while I endure an endless parade of dreary balls and insufferable suitors to make a favorable match. But I have another ideaโa business ventureโto save my family. All I need are investors.
And as for Briggs? Heโs hiding a secret as well: heโs flat broke.
Now the person I loathe the most in this world is just as trapped as I amโboth penniless and our households depending on us to save them. And I think I know how. All I have to do is play nice with the very devil Iโve sworn to hateโฆ
His society connections can boost me from near obscurity to help me win over investors for my business. And perhaps I can help him woo an aloof heiress with deep pockets. Itโs a long shot. It might even workโฆbut do I want it to?


Erica George is the author of young adult romances such asย Witty in Pinkย (Entangled Teen, 2024),ย The Edge of Summerย (Little, Brown BFYR, 2022), andย Words Composed of Sea and Skyย (Running Press, 2021). She is a graduate of The College of New Jersey with degrees in both English and education, and holds an MFA in Writing for Children and Young Adults from Vermont College of Fine Arts. She is currently a writing instructor at the University of Pennsylvania, residing in northwest New Jersey but spending her summers soaking up the salty sea air on Cape Cod. Many themes in Ericaโs writing rotate around environmental activism and young people finding their voice. When sheโs not writing, you can find her exploring river towns, whale watching, or engrossed in quality British dramas with her dog at her side.
